i just received uri caines new w&w release with his interpretation of gustav mahler songs and to be honest I was really disappointed. i know the discussion about this topic in general has already been around but anyhow I really, really liked the first mahler disc urlicht. i still think it's absolutly ok to take "classic" material and transform it into something new. to my ears this worked fine on urlicht. the follow-up schuhmann disc had some interesting moments as well. with the next disc being interpretations of bach pieces the whole thing turned out to be a kind of series. this is still fine, why not draw material from the classic composers. the bach stuff also was a total mixture of genres and different ensembles, some worked fine others did not. but at this time I felt this stuff is somehow really overproduced and I started to miss the vibe. my assumption is that there is someone, maybe the guys from w&w, "producing" the music way to much. I found the mahler songs totally unfocused. A narrative speaker repeating "die Gedanken sind frei" over and over sounds terrible. The words are ok, the idea is ok but it all fells damned cold.
